      This is the start of Pride month. I have friends, acquaintances, and family members in most if not all LGBTQ+ categories, and probably you do too although you may not know it. I wish they all could live lives of being who they want to be without being socially or legally hassled. I made this flag in computer language R.

      Here is the R code:

 # Draw empty plot
plot(NULL, col = "white", xlim = c(0, 12), ylim = c(0, 8), xlab="", xaxt="n", ylab="", yaxt="n", 
    main="LGBTQ+ Rainbow Flag" ) 

polygon(x = c(3.33, 12, 12, 2), y = c(6.67, 6.67, 8, 8), col = "#e40303")  # coordinates counter-
    clockwise; red                  
polygon(x = c(4.67, 12, 12, 3.33), y = c(5.33, 5.33, 6.67, 6.67), col = "#ff8c00") # orange
polygon(x = c(6, 12, 12, 4.67), y = c(4, 4, 5.33, 5.33), col = "#ffed00") # yellow
polygon(x = c(4.67, 12, 12, 6), y = c(2.67, 2.67, 4, 4), col = "#008026") # green
polygon(x = c(3.33, 12, 12, 4.67), y = c(1.33, 1.33, 2.67, 2.67), col = "#004dff") # blue
polygon(x = c(2, 12, 12, 3.33), y = c(0, 0, 1.33, 1.33), col = "#750787") # purple

polygon(x = c(1, 2, 6, 2, 1, 5), y = c(0, 0, 4, 8, 8,4), col = "#000000") # black
polygon(x = c(0, 1, 5, 1, 0, 4), y = c(0, 0, 4, 8, 8, 4), col = "#613915") # brown
polygon(x = c(0, 0, 4, 0, 0, 3), y = c(1.33, 0, 4, 8, 6.67, 4), col = "#74d7ee") # light blue
polygon(x = c(0, 0, 3, 0, 0, 2), y = c(2.67, 1.33, 4, 6.67, 5.33, 4), col = "#ffafc8") # pink
polygon(x = c(0, 0, 2), y = c(5.33, 2.67, 4), col = "#ffffff") # white
